Summary:The aim of the project is to create a shielding for Boron Neuron Capture Therapy (BNCT) experiment at thermal colum channel of TRIGA MARK II PUSPATI nicler reactor BNCT traditionally involves injecting tumours with the non-radioactive boron-10 isotope captureagent that is then radiated with a beam of epithermal neutrons that interact with the capture agent to produce a biologically destructive nuclear caption reaction.
